About American Water American Water (NYSE: AWK) is the largest regulated water and wastewater utility company in the United States. With a history dating back to 1886, We Keep Life Flowing® by providing safe, clean, reliable and affordable drinking water and wastewater services to more than 14 million people across 14 regulated jurisdictions and 18 military installations. American Water's 6,500 talented professionals leverage their significant expertise and the company's national size and scale to achieve excellent outcomes for the benefit of customers, employees, investors and other stakeholders. As one of the fastest growing utilities in the U.S., American Water expects to invest $30 to $34 billion in infrastructure repairs and replacement, system resiliency and regulated acquisitions over the next 10 years. The company has a long-standing history of executing its core operations, aligned with sustainable best practices, through its commitments to safety, affordability, customer service, protecting the environment, an inclusive workforce and strengthening communities. American Water has been recognized on the 2023 Bloomberg Gender-Equality Indexfor the fifth consecutive year, ranked 18th on Barron's 100 Most Sustainable U.S. Companies 2023 List, earned the U.S. Department of Homeland Security SAFETY Act designation and U.S. Environmental Protection Agency's WaterSense® Excellence Award, among additional state, local and national recognitions. Primary Role Responsible for the preventive and corrective maintenance of the facility and support equipment. Also provides assistance with inventory control which may include shipping and/or receiving goods and equipmen which may include shipping and/or receiving goods and equipment. Work schedule: Monday - Friday 7:30 AM - 4:30 PM plus rotating on-call schedule. Key Accountabilities To perform work assigned by supervision. To collect, compile and record equipment data, involving some use of pc or mobile device based documentation and test equipment. To perform work necessary in the maintenance of production facilities and equipment. The individual must have a working knowledge of electrical, electronic, and mechanical equipment to include, but not limited to, multi-meters, ammeters, and calibrators. The individual will also perform work on low and medium voltage equipment, pumps, electric motors, ariable frequency drives, motor control centers, SCADA systems, recorders, mechanical /electrical / hydraulic /electronic valves and operators, electronic monitoring and output devices, ultrasonic and radar level reading devices, air compressors, blowers, communication equipment, diesel generators and engines, and various types of plumbing. To read and interpret electrical/electronic and mechanical drawings, prints, schematics, layouts, etc. They will be familiar with and proficient in the use of electrical/electronic test equipment Responsible for routine checks of equipment, facilities, and security measures as deemed appropriate by the organization / supervisor. To assist other employees in the performance of their work. To report to supervisor requirements for adequate inventory of maintenance parts and supplies. To maintain open communication with all team members. To be on rotating call with other personnel and work overtime as required. To inform other work areas and other personnel of situations which affect company operations. To follow all federal, state, local and company regulations and policies. Knowledge/Skills Knowledge of basic math calculations such as proportions, percentages, area, circumference, & volume. Must have working knowledge of Microsoft Office products, such as MS Word, MS Excel and be able to utilize mobile devices proficiently (tablets, smart phones, etc) Experience/Education High school graduate or state recognized educational equivalency required. A degree or certificate from a two-year course of study in electricity/ electronics (or related field) and or Masters Electricians license; or at least six (6) years experience in maintaining, troubleshooting, repairing, testing and calibrating electrical and electronic equipment. Applicant must score at or above the national average on provided assessment testing. Valid drivers license required with the ability to pass background check. Work Environment Must be able to satisfactorily pass company's physical examination. Must be able to perform such activities as walking, stooping, lifting 75 pounds, climbing, working in damp spaces, working in closed spaces, working outdoors in all weather conditions, working on and around water treatment chemicals and feed systems with appropriate safety devices and measures. Must be able to follow oral and written instructions. Must be able to distinguish colors. Must be able to obtain Hepatitis vaccine upon employment. Must be able to follow company dress and conduct codes. Must be able to use when needed self-contained breathing apparatus, dust masks, chemical hygiene suits, and other safety related equipment.
